Bhutan lifts ban on some TV channels

MUMBAI: Bhutan, which had earlier restricted the airing of several television channels in the country, has finally approved to lift the ban on such channels as Zee Muzic, MTV, Ten Sports, Channel V and STC Music.

Almost five years back, based on a 2004 media impact study report, the then Bhutan communication authority had stopped the broadcasting of various TV channels that showcased excessive violence, glamorising drugs, and explicit content. The banning included channels such as MTV, Channel V and Zee Muzic, FTV and Ten Sports.

The Bhutan Infocom and Communication authority (BICMA) has, however, asked cable operators to refrain from airing channels that broadcast explicit or violent content.

Meanwhile, BICMA Head-telecommunication Wangay Dorji has informed PTI that the government is working on modalities regarding content of channels available under DTH.
